Lasting Materials Driving Innovation
One of one of the most significant growths in future generation product packaging remedies is the fostering of sustainable products. Conventional petroleum-based plastics can take centuries to break down, leading to extreme environmental pollution. To address this concern, companies are establishing biodegradable and compostable materials derived from renewable energies such as cornstarch, sugarcane, bamboo, algae, and mushroom mycelium. Bioplastics have actually become an encouraging choice due to the fact that they lower dependancy on nonrenewable fuel sources while reducing greenhouse gas exhausts during manufacturing. Paper-based product packaging has actually likewise gotten appeal because of its high recyclability and widespread customer acceptance. In addition, molded fiber packaging is increasingly changing plastic trays and containers in industries such as food solution, electronic devices, and health care.
These cutting-edge materials help reduce garbage dump waste while supporting global sustainability goals. As producing modern technologies boost, sustainable product packaging materials remain to end up being more affordable and commercially practical.
Smart Product Packaging Technologies
Digital improvement has actually introduced clever product packaging as one of the most exciting facets of future generation packaging options. Smart packaging incorporates modern technologies such as QR codes, Near Area Communication (NFC), Radio Frequency Recognition (RFID), temperature level sensing units, and freshness indicators into packaging systems.
Customers can scan QR codes making use of mobile phones to access product information, verify credibility, find out about recycling instructions, or trace an item’s beginning throughout the supply chain. This openness constructs customer trust while helping business deal with counterfeit items.
In the food and pharmaceutical markets, smart packaging can check temperature level changes, humidity levels, and product quality. Sensing units can notify stores or consumers when products are coming close to perishing, decreasing food waste and improving security. These modern technologies likewise allow real-time supply administration, raising operational effectiveness throughout supply chains.
Circular Economy and Reusable Product Packaging
The concept of a circular economy is reshaping packaging strategies worldwide. As opposed to following the standard “take, make, and dispose” version, circular packaging stresses lowering waste with reuse, recycling, and material recovery.
Recyclable product packaging systems are coming to be progressively typical in ecommerce, grocery store shipment, and industrial logistics. Durable containers, refillable containers, and returnable shipping boxes can dramatically decrease single-use packaging waste. Several firms have actually presented refill stations where consumers can replenish house products such as detergents, shampoos, and cleaning supplies without acquiring brand-new containers.
Boosted reusing modern technologies also enable suppliers to include recycled products into brand-new packaging without endangering top quality. Closed-loop recycling systems assist conserve natural deposits while reducing environmental effect.

Difficulties Facing Next Generation Product Packaging
In spite of rapid progress, a number of difficulties remain in executing next generation packaging options. Lasting products frequently cost greater than conventional plastics, making fostering tough for smaller organizations. Restricted reusing facilities in lots of countries additionally decreases the performance of recyclable product packaging.
Biodegradable materials call for certain industrial composting problems that may not be extensively available. Moreover, balancing sustainability with durability, food security, and regulative conformity stays a complicated design challenge.
Financial investment in research and development, helpful federal government plans, and cooperation across markets will certainly be essential to getting over these barriers.
